KMEW NSE filing

Clarification on Proposed Allottees in Preferential Issue

The RealCase readLow impact Neutral

KMEW clarifies the status of proposed allottees in its preferential issue, responding to an NSE query. The list includes both non-promoter and promoter entities with details of their holdings and allocations.

* Clarification on the current and proposed status of proposed allottees in the preferential issue. * Information provided in response to NSE query letter dated October 8, 2025. * Lists the names of proposed allottees, their current status, pre-issue holdings (as on September 12, 2025), number of securities to be allotted, and proposed status. * Allottees include Infinity Direct Holdings, Infinity Direct Capital, Infinity Partners II - Direct, Ashish Kacholia, Vimana Capital Management LLP, Suryashakti Management Services Private Limited and Sujay Kewalramani. * Sujay Kewalramani is classified as a promoter, considering the conversion of warrants into equity shares.
